Bollywood actor Ajay Devgn and South actor Kichcha Sudeepa are seen at war on Twitter over Hindi (Hindi). In fact, these two were debating and now after their debate, many other stars have also jumped into this debate. Former Karnataka Chief Minister and Congress leader Siddaramaiah has also jumped into the controversy that has arisen out of a statement made by Kiccha Sudeep in the past few days. In fact, Ajay Devgan called Hindi a national language, now Siddaramaiah retweeted his tweet and wrote, "Hindi our national language was never and never will be.''

Along with this, Padma Shri TV Mohandas Pai has advised Ajay Devgan to read the Constitution. In fact, Siddaramaiah wrote in his tweet, "It is the duty of every Indian to respect the linguistic diversity of the country. Every language has its own rich history, and people are proud of it. I am proud to be Kannada. On the other hand, Padma Shri TV Mohandas Pai has also reacted to the Hindi controversy. In fact, he wrote, "According to our Constitution, is there a national language of India? No, there are many official languages in the country. Why is Ajay Devgn making such statements and creating unnecessary controversies? They should read the Constitution. ’

This controversy over Hindi started when South actor Kiccha Sudeep said at an event, "Hindi is not our national language. Pan India films are being made in Kannada. I would like to make a correction on this. Hindi is no longer a national language. Pan India films are being done in Bollywood at the moment. They are also struggling by remaking Telugu and Tamil films. But the films we are making are being seen all over the world. Bollywood actor Ajay Devgan tweeted, "Kiccha Sudeep, my brother, according to you, if Hindi is not our national language, why do you release your mother tongue films by dubbing them in Hindi? Hindi was, is and always will be our mother tongue and national language. The people's mind. '
